Output 583c77f6313c706180f63d4213fa780950e70cf7d27dfedf481aadd386e60609:3

value
6674018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ee9f14a1e48a4dcf423278269de21f70b22e8cd0 OP_EQUAL
address
3PSjKK6wjFqf2zBP6u8QuhH2UBLbrYeBLy
transaction
583c77f6313c706180f63d4213fa780950e70cf7d27dfedf481aadd386e60609
spent
true